1
resposta

Bug bolinha-raquete

Bom dia,

Gostaria de entender o por que em dado momento do jogo a bolinha fica travada entre a raquete e a borda. Começa normal mas conforme vou jogando da esse bug.

Segue o link para observar. - https://scratch.mit.edu/projects/855298598/editor/

Já tentei várias alternativas mudando os passo da bolinha e a subtração da posiçãoYAgradeço.

1 resposta

Olá Ana, tudo bem?

Pelo que pude observar no seu jogo, o problema ocorre quando a bolinha atinge a raquete em um ângulo muito fechado, fazendo com que ela fique "preso" entre a raquete e a borda.

Uma possível solução para esse problema é adicionar uma verificação para identificar quando a bolinha está em contato com a raquete e, nesse caso, alterar a direção da bolinha para evitar que ela fique presa.

Você pode fazer isso adicionando um novo bloco "se" dentro do bloco "se a bolinha tocar na raquete" e verificar se a bolinha está em contato com a raquete em um ângulo muito fechado. Se sim, você pode alterar a direção da bolinha para evitar que ela fique presa.

Espero ter ajudado e bons estudos!